Hi

is it possible to have the server decide what stream the client gets to
view?

basically, we want to be able to play a short pre-recorded "welcome" movie
(.FLV) when a user first enters a room. As soon as this has finished playing
they are then automatically switched to the live stream.

then again, on disconnect (or if they are kicked out by the host) we want to
play a "goodbye" movie before disconnecting them.

it seems to me that the client is ultimately responsible for what it wants
to see and there is no way for the server to interrupt this and push
something different to them... true?

Cheers, Ben.
